3-methoxypropylamine

CAS 5332-73-0 · C4H11NO
Hazard class
Danger — Flammable, Corrosive, Irritant / harmful
Pictograms
FlammableCorrosiveIrritant / harmful
H-statements
  • H226 Flammable liquid and vapour
  • H302 Harmful if swallowed
  • H314 Causes severe skin burns and eye damage
  • H317 May cause an allergic skin reaction
  • H318 Causes serious eye damage
  • H412 Harmful to aquatic life with long lasting effects
Synonyms
226-241-3 · 3-Methoxypropylamine · 1-Amino-3-methoxypropane · 1-Propanamine, 3-methoxy- · Propylamine, 3-methoxy- · Propanolamine methyl ether · gamma-Methoxypropylamine · 3MOPA cpd
Molecular weight
89.14 g/mol
Data source
Aggregated classification PubChem · REACH-registered
GHS aggregated by PubChem from registrant and agency submissions; not individually harmonised. Always verify against the official SDS before compliance use.
